Kang Daewon is the kind of character you love to hate at first—super arrogant, blunt, and totally obsessed with work. But as 'My Arrogant Boss' unfolds, you see glimpses of why he’s like that, and dang, it hits hard. Lee Hana’s the perfect foil for him; she’s not some naive protagonist but someone who challenges him while growing herself. The show’s smart about not making their dynamic one-sided. Even smaller roles, like Daewon’s rival CEO Choi Hyunseok, add tension without feeling cartoonish. It’s rare for a rom-com to give villains actual depth!

What stood out to me in 'My Arrogant Boss' was how the characters avoid clichés. Kang Daewon could’ve been a generic cold CEO, but his backstory with his family adds layers—you understand his arrogance isn’t just for show. Lee Hana’s not a pushover either; she’s got her own ambitions beyond romance. And can we talk about the office ensemble? Kim Sora’s comedic timing is gold, and Park Joon’s deadpan reactions to Daewon’s antics make the workplace feel alive. The writing lets everyone shine, even in quieter moments like Hana’s heart-to-hearts with Minji. It’s a cast that makes you wish you worked at their company (minus the drama, maybe).

I binge-watched 'My Arrogant Boss' last weekend, and it’s such a fun mix of workplace drama and romance! The main cast totally carries the story. There’s Kang Daewon, the CEO who’s all sharp edges and sarcasm but secretly has a soft spot for his team. Then you have Lee Hana, the determined new employee who isn’t afraid to call him out—their chemistry is electric.

Supporting characters like the quirky office manager Kim Sora and the perpetually exhausted but loyal assistant Park Joon add so much life to the show. Honestly, what makes it work is how even the side characters feel fully realized, like Hana’s best friend Yoon Minji, who steals every scene with her chaotic energy. The way the show balances humor with emotional moments through these characters is just chef’s kiss.

Who are the main characters in Arrogance Boss Is My Secret?

3 Answers2026-05-20 20:23:17
The web novel 'Arrogance Boss Is My Secret' has this addictive dynamic between its two leads that just hooks you. The female protagonist, Jiang Xia, is this brilliant but low-key programmer who ends up working under her cold, domineering CEO boss, Lu Yan. What makes their chemistry sizzle is the secret identity twist—she’s actually the anonymous hacker he’s been obsessively trying to recruit, and neither realizes it at first. Lu Yan’s arrogance masks his growing fascination with her, while Jiang Xia’s quiet competence slowly chips away at his icy exterior. The supporting cast adds flavor too, like the gossipy office colleague who accidentally fuels half the misunderstandings, and Lu Yan’s rival CEO who keeps testing their relationship. It’s one of those stories where the side characters don’t just feel like props—they nudge the main duo into hilariously awkward situations or emotional breakthroughs. The way Jiang Xia’s hidden skills clash with Lu Yan’s control-freak tendencies makes every chapter a delicious tension bomb waiting to explode. Honestly, what sold me on this novel wasn’t just the romance but how it plays with power dynamics. Jiang Xia could easily outshine Lu Yan with her hacking prowess, but she chooses to play along in this corporate chess game, and that subtle power balance keeps things unpredictable. Even the ‘arrogance’ in the title isn’t one-dimensional—you see glimpses of why Lu Yan is the way he is, and his vulnerability sneaks up on you when you least expect it.

Who are the main characters in 'My Billionaire Boss'?

1 Answers2026-05-24 16:53:16
The heart of 'My Billionaire Boss' revolves around two central figures who couldn’t be more different yet end up tangled in the most deliciously chaotic way. First, there’s Ethan Blackwood—cold, calculating, and the kind of billionaire who could freeze hell over with one glare. He’s the CEO of Blackwood Industries, a man who built his empire from scratch but has zero patience for anything resembling emotional weakness. Then there’s Mia Carter, the fiery, quick-witted assistant who stumbles into his world after a mix-up at the temp agency. She’s all sunshine and sarcasm, the kind of person who’d argue with a brick wall just for fun. Their dynamic is pure gold, with Mia constantly chipping away at Ethan’s icy exterior while he begrudgingly starts to appreciate her chaos. Supporting characters add so much flavor to the story. There’s Daniel, Ethan’s childhood friend and the company’s COO, who plays the role of the charming mediator—always trying to smooth things over between Ethan and Mia. Then you have Olivia, Mia’s best friend and roommate, who’s equal parts hype woman and voice of reason. She’s the one who drags Mia out for margaritas after every workplace meltdown. And let’s not forget Harper, Ethan’s ex-fiancée, who slinks back into the picture like a villain in a telenovela, stirring up trouble just when things start to get interesting. The cast feels like a messy, dysfunctional family you can’t help but root for, even when they’re making terrible decisions. What I love about 'My Billionaire Boss' is how these characters aren’t just cardboard cutouts. Ethan’s gruffness hides a backstory full of betrayal, and Mia’s optimism masks her own struggles with self-doubt. Even the side characters get moments to shine, like Daniel’s secret soft spot for baking or Olivia’s disastrous dating life. It’s one of those stories where everyone feels real, like people you might actually know—if your friends happened to be ridiculously attractive and prone to dramatic confrontations in elevators.
